Assuming there weren't any of these hypothetical legal failsafes against a release of the unaltered trilogy embedded in the Disney deal, wouldn't it behoove Fox to put something out sooner rather than later? It's not like Disney's never going to release another box set, SE or otherwise, and since Fox owns ANH until the end of time, Disney is going to have to make some kind of deal with them to do it. Shouldn't Fox want to get the ball rolling on that while they still have the distribution rights to the other two films (which I believe move to Disney in 2020)? I'm legitimately asking, I don't even really know if this is how distribution rights work, but it does seem to me like it would be better for Fox if this release came while they control all three films rather than one.
